FAIRFIELD — The city will meet with school officials Tuesday to present its proposal to turn the vacant Sullivan Middle School into a youth services center, which could one day house the Matt Garcia PAL Center.
The Fairfield-Suisun School District will hold a joint meeting with city staff and police to discuss housing several services under one roof. The meeting takes place at 5:30 p.m. at the district office located at 2490 Hilborn Road.
Dubbed the Interagency Youth Services Center for now, City Manager Sean Quinn said he hopes it will become a place for troubled youth to get the resources they need to avoid suspension or expulsion. He also talked about a home for mentoring and tutoring for children.
